## Changelog — Ticktrace 1.9

### Renamed: DRIFT_API_TOKEN
During the cron drift investigation we found plugins confusing this variable with the metrics token, so it has been renamed to indicate it authorizes drift-report uploads specifically. Plugin authors must read the new name from 1.9 onward; the old name is ignored without warning. Sample env files in the SDK are updated. In your deployment env file, the drift-report upload secret is set on the next line.

env line for fawef-taguf: VAULT_KEY13=a9695905a9a90

## Runbook: Gaugepile Sidecar — Release Checklist

Heads up: the sidecar ships with every app pod, so a bad config fans out fast. Before cutting a release, confirm the flush interval hasn't drifted from what the Tallyhouse aggregator expects, or you'll see sawtooth gaps in dashboards. Rollbacks are cheap — just repin the image tag. Canary one node pool first, watch for ten minutes, then proceed. The values to verify against are these.

config for bagep-yafof:
quenath:
  pin: 8584
  metrics_host: metrics.quenath.tolvaqsys.internal
  tenant: pelath
  seal: seal_ed102645

**Q: The Flowgauge autoscaler stopped scaling on queue depth — what do I do?**

A: Usually the metrics poller lost its credential after a vault reseal. Restart the poller first; if it still can't authenticate, unseal manually from the on-call bastion. You'll be prompted once. Enter the recovery passphrase exactly as written on the line below.

unlock words, yawig-kagef: gordor-holvan-ulaael-pramir-ulaiel-tamdor

Ticket: Slotwright timetable solver produces infeasible schedules when a teacher has exactly two availability windows separated by a lunch block. The pruning pass in the window-merge step appears to drop the second window, so the solver reports false conflicts for roughly 3% of staff at the Fernhollow pilot school. Reviewer: please check the interval-coalescing change in the merge routine and the attached failing fixture. The regression first appears in the build noted below.

pipeline stamp: htk21_4adfc7a400dc735eb9849